CallipygianKing Posted July 25, 2006 Share Posted July 25, 2006 I think the only problem with the Blue Stars uniform is the lack of a buckle. Cesario wanted to replace their buckle with a mirror the last time they got new unis, and that prompted them to go to Stanbury. Quote Link to comment Share on other sites More sharing options...
